Quote: If you have the 1588, I can help you!!

If it's at 97, you'll want to raise it two degrees.
Look on the underside and in the square hole, you'll see 8 switches.
The #4 switch should be turned on.
Turn it off and turn on the #7 switch.

Let me know what it does.

Hope this helps.
